IDF says it struck Hezbollah sites after truce mechanism was notified but failed to address threats |
2025-01-13 |
[IsraelTimes] The IDF says it has struck several Hezbollah targets Sunday night, including a rocket launcher, an unspecified military site, and "routes along the Syria-Leb![]() border used to smuggle weapons to Hezbollah." The military says that before the strikes, it made the threats known to an international mechanism set up as part of the ongoing ceasefire between Israel and Hezbollah, but "the threats weren’t addressed." "The IDF continues to act to remove any threat to the State of Israel and will operate to prevent any attempt by Hezbollah to rebuild its forces in accordance with the ceasefire understandings," the IDF adds. Lebanese media report additional Israeli airstrikes in Beqaa Valley, near border with Syria Lebanese media report IDF airstrikes in Nabatieh District, some 17 km north of Israel border [IsraelTimes] Lebanese media report Israeli airstrikes in the village of Houmine al-Faouqa, in the Nabatieh District. The village is located north of the Litani River, some 17 kilometers (some 10.5 miles) from Israel’s border. |
